The Interconnection of Exercise and Sleep
The relationship between exercise and sleep is multifaceted, with each affecting the other in significant ways. Engaging in regular physical activity can lead to improved sleep quality, while adequate rest can enhance exercise performance.
Benefits of Exercise on Sleep
Physical activity, especially moderate-intensity exercise, is known to improve sleep disorders more effectively than low- or high-intensity workouts. This enhancement is observed in sleep quality, duration, and efficiency. Aerobic activities tend to have a more substantial impact on sleep improvement compared to resistance exercises.
Mind-body exercises, such as yoga, have been shown to improve mood and mental health, which can further enhance sleep quality. The diverse effects of exercise on sleep can vary depending on individual characteristics and types of exercise undertaken.
Impact of Sleep on Exercise Performance
Getting sufficient sleep is crucial for optimizing exercise performance. Sleep aids in muscle recovery, energy restoration, and mental focus, all of which are essential for physical activities. Poor sleep can lead to decreased motivation, increased perception of effort, and lower endurance during workouts.
Athletes and fitness enthusiasts often experience enhanced performance with adequate sleep. Improved concentration, faster reaction times, and better mood are noted benefits, highlighting the need to prioritize sleep as part of a comprehensive fitness regimen. Adequate rest supports both physical and mental facets of fitness, reinforcing the importance of maintaining healthy sleep habits.
Optimizing Exercise for Better Sleep
Regular physical activity can play a significant role in improving sleep quality. By focusing on the timing and type of exercise, individuals can enhance their ability to fall asleep faster and enjoy a more restful night.
Best Time to Exercise
The timing of exercise can greatly influence its effectiveness on sleep. Some individuals experience better sleep when they exercise in the morning. This aligns their body with natural circadian rhythms, promoting alertness during daylight and relaxation when night falls.
For others, an evening workout contributes to better sleep. It can soothe anxiety and help the body transition into relaxation mode. Yet, vigorous exercises close to bedtime might lead to increased alertness and hinder falling asleep.
Therefore, the optimal time can vary. It’s beneficial to experiment and find what works best for the individual’s routine. Listening to the body’s signals helps in determining the most effective time for physical activity to boost sleep.
Types of Exercise for Sleep Improvement
Engaging in aerobic exercises like walking, running, or cycling can greatly enhance sleep quality. These activities elevate heart rate and improve cardiovascular health, leading to more restorative sleep.
Resistance training, such as weightlifting, also plays a critical role. Incorporating strength exercises fosters deeper sleep cycles and reduces sleep disruptions.
Mind-body exercises like yoga and tai chi are excellent for those experiencing sleep troubles due to stress or anxiety. They reduce stress levels and help achieve a state of tranquility before bedtime.
It’s essential to choose exercise routines that align with personal preferences and fitness goals. This encourages consistency and aids in establishing a regular sleep-enhancing exercise regimen.
Understanding Sleep Cycles
Sleep cycles consist of several stages, each playing a crucial role in physical and mental well-being. These stages impact recovery processes like muscle repair, making understanding them vital for optimizing health.
Stages of Sleep
Sleep is organized into cycles, typically lasting around 90 minutes. Each cycle includes four stages. The initial stage is light sleep, where the individual may still perceive surroundings. Following this is the second stage, which features a decrease in heart rate and temperature, preparing the body for deep sleep. The third stage, known as deep sleep or slow-wave sleep, is crucial for restorative processes such as tissue growth.
Finally, the REM (Rapid Eye Movement) stage involves increased brain activity, vivid dreaming, and plays a role in memory consolidation. Understanding these stages is critical, as people spend the majority of their sleep in various cycles, with stage 2 being predominant according to National Institute of Neurological Disorders and Stroke.
Role of Sleep in Recovery
Sleep plays a pivotal role in physical recovery. During the deep sleep stage, the body releases growth hormone, facilitating tissue repair and muscle growth. This process is vital for anyone involved in regular physical activity, as it enhances performance and recovery rates. The importance of sleep is further underlined in its impact on the immune system. Reduced sleep quality can impair immune function, making individuals more susceptible to illnesses.
Moreover, REM sleep aids in emotional and cognitive recovery. It helps in organizing thoughts, consolidating memories, and processing emotions, contributing to better mental health.
